Output 68f3b417e72237069c77fdc17dc1bf80d1f893bdf4e9aaabd4dbc425a5812050:5

value
3761083306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51fc8c63a15b5c772483a0fdfdcca96a3cf74166 OP_EQUAL
address
39AXCTBGZxXDVMDgCRTRd68ymuLq4Wnmfy
transaction
68f3b417e72237069c77fdc17dc1bf80d1f893bdf4e9aaabd4dbc425a5812050
spent
true